| Looseboots Gmail is one of the safest (if not the safest) free e-mail providers on the internet. Their spam filtering is second to none and also their pre-emptive warnings about e-mails that may not be from the shown sender are also a reason to use Gmail. Personally I would now not use any other free e-mail provider. And if you decide to change to Gmail then you can import all of the contacts from your existing provider easily. |

| Personaly I am not a fan of any web based interface for mail but always prefer a dedicated client. I have used many over the years and currently am using Windows live mail, from which I collect my mail from my main email account (erolz@cream.org) and also from my gmail account and from my hotmail account all in one integrated, non web based place. I will only use web based interfaces when I am in need of checking and sending mails and am away from my own main machine, which to me is the only advantage web based access has vs using a dedicated email client. |
